Which of the following is/are tributary/tributaries of Brahmaputra?1.Dibang2.Kameng3.LohitSelect the correct answer using the code given below

A 1 only
B 2 and 3 only
C 1 and 3 only
D 1, 2 and 3

Correct answer: (d) 1, 2 and 3

Explanation

  1. A

    1 only

    Dibang only. Dibang is a left-bank Brahmaputra tributary in Arunachal, but Kameng and Lohit also join the same system. 1 alone is incomplete.

  2. B

    2 and 3 only

    2 and 3 only. Kameng and Lohit are Brahmaputra tributaries, yet omitting Dibang is wrong. This letter is not the key.

  3. C

    1 and 3 only

    1 and 3 only. Dibang and Lohit are correct; Kameng (Jia Bharali) is also a north-bank tributary in Assam/Arunachal. Dropping 2 is not the key.

  4. D

    1, 2 and 3

    1, 2 and 3. Dibang, Kameng and Lohit are all tributaries of the Brahmaputra in the eastern Himalayan basin. That stored letter is the official key.

Summary. Official key is (d) 1, 2 and 3. Dibang, Lohit and Kameng all feed the Brahmaputra. Honour the stored letter (d).
